{site_name}

{site_name}

🌜 搜索

在PHP中,pg_fetch_array函数用于从查询结果中获取一行数据,并以关联数组或数字索引数组的形式返回该行数据

php 𝄐 0
php pgsql,php pgsql 总提示密码不正确,php pgsql扩展,php pgsql 大字符串 提交,php pgsql 长字符串 提交,phpPgAdmin
在PHP中,pg_fetch_array函数用于从查询结果中获取一行数据,并以关联数组或数字索引数组的形式返回该行数据。

使用pg_fetch_array的一般语法如下所示:
$result = pg_query($connection, $query); // 执行查询语句
$row = pg_fetch_array($result); // 获取一行数据

其中,$connection是与PostgreSQL数据库建立的连接对象,$query是要执行的查询语句。

pg_fetch_array函数可以接受两个参数,第一个参数是查询结果集的资源,第二个参数是可选的,用于指定返回数组类型。如果不指定第二个参数,默认返回关联数组。

如果要使用数字索引数组返回数据,可以指定第二个参数为PGSQL_NUM。

下面是一个使用pg_fetch_array的示例代码:
$result = pg_query($connection, "SELECT * FROM table_name"); // 执行查询语句
while ($row = pg_fetch_array($result)) {
echo $row['column_name']; // 输出某个列的值
echo $row[0]; // 输出第一个列的值
// 处理数据...
}

在上面的示例中,首先执行了查询语句,然后通过while循环遍历查询结果集中的每一行,使用$row变量接收每一行的数据。可以通过列名或索引访问每个列的值。

希望这能够帮助到你!如果有其他问题,请随时提问。